Transaction 70252c5c5839d32bae5bbc070992693e3a3cbddc06f18af3f3f9527f22d90e48

2 Input
1 Outputs
  • 70252c5c5839d32bae5bbc070992693e3a3cbddc06f18af3f3f9527f22d90e48:0
  • value  2967826
    address  1PtQSEU432wo1w3jbd8XQGMMmNiV9Qq3G5